Navigating Consumer Discretionary Market Trends with the XLY ETF
The XLY ETF provides a compelling way to tap into the dynamic consumer discretionary market. This sector, characterized by companies that create goods and services perceived non-essential, is often highly sensitive to economic fluctuations. Investors seeking to harness the potential growth of this sector tend to consider the XLY ETF as a valuable tool in their portfolios.
Understanding the key trends shaping consumer discretionary spending is vital for investors looking to effectively deploy this ETF. Factors such as shifting consumer preferences, technological innovations, and global economic conditions can all materially affect the performance of the XLY ETF.
